The Temporary Certified Special Education Teacherwill work in the elementary emotional support private school setting. The teacher provides a nurturing environment for children to maintain academic instruction while learning pro-social skills. The teacher is responsible for the implementation of the Individual Education Plan (IEP)/Comprehensive Evaluation Report (CER) for each student in CGRC's Elementary Education Services. The teacher is responsible for daily lesson plans that incorporate Common Core teaching standards for Pennsylvania.

CGRC's Elementary Education Services (EES) Program is a licensed, private Special Education School for children in grades K-8 in Delaware County who are struggling in their public school classroom. Our school is a structured academic environment, much like mainstream classrooms, and teaches an academic curriculum but with a strong emphasis on social, emotional, and behavioral development.

The goal for every child in our Elementary Education Services (EES) is to learn the skills necessary to return successfully to his/her own public school district. Our structured academic environment combined with group therapy, individual counseling, and on-site psychiatric services provides the safe and supportive environment students need.
